R. 2780 I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ES April 9, 2025 Mr. Kennedy of New York introduced the following bill; which was referred to the Committee on Agriculture A BILL To temporarily expand the supplemental nutrition assistance program income eligibility of households that include certain veterans. 1. Short title This Act may be cited as the Setting the Table for Transition Act . 2. Temporary expanded SNAP income eligibility of households that include certain veterans For the purpose of determining income under the Food and Nutrition Act of 2008 ( 7 U.S.C. 2011 et seq. ) during the 100-day period that begins on the date a veteran receives a Report of Separation (DD form 214) of a household that includes a member who is a veteran, only the income of such veteran shall be considered. 3. Definition For purposes of this Act, the term veteran means an individual who served in the active military, naval, or air service, and who was discharged or released therefrom under conditions other than dishonorable. 4. Effective date This Act shall take effect 90 days after the date of the enactment of this Act.
